Photovoltaic system repair services focus on restoring and maintaining the functionality of solar energy systems. These services typically involve diagnosing issues with solar panels, inverters, wiring, and other system components. Repair professionals assess the condition of the equipment, identify faulty parts or connections, and perform necessary replacements or adjustments to ensure optimal performance. Regular inspections and timely repairs can help prevent minor issues from escalating into more significant system failures, supporting consistent energy production.
Addressing common problems such as decreased energy output, inverter malfunctions, damaged panels, or wiring faults is a primary goal of photovoltaic system repair. Over time, exposure to weather elements, dirt accumulation, or electrical wear can impair system efficiency. Repair services help resolve these issues by replacing damaged panels, fixing faulty wiring, recalibrating inverters, or upgrading components as needed. This ensures that the solar system functions reliably and continues to generate energy effectively.

Repair Costs - The typical cost for photovoltaic system repairs ranges from $300 to $1,500, depending on the extent of the damage. Minor component replacements, such as inverters or wiring, tend to be on the lower end of this range. Larger repairs or panel replacements may approach the higher end or exceed it.
Component Replacement - Replacing damaged solar panels or inverters usually costs between $200 and $1,200 per component. The total cost depends on the number of units needing replacement and the specific models involved. Service providers may charge additional labor fees for installation.
Labor Expenses - Labor charges for photovoltaic system repairs typically fall between $50 and $150 per hour. The overall labor cost depends on the complexity of the repair and the local service provider's rates. Most repairs take a few hours to complete.
Additional Fees - Some repairs may include additional costs such as permit fees or system diagnostics, which can add $50 to $300 to the total. These fees vary based on local regulations and the scope of the repair work needed.
Actual totals will depend on details like access to the work area, the scope of the project, and the materials selected, so use these as general starting points rather than exact figures.
